Processor Specs
| Intel Core 2 Duo E4400 | Processor | Intel Core 2 Duo T5550 |
| 2000 MHz | Frequency | 1830 MHz |
| 2 | Cores | 2 |
| 2 | Threads | 2 |
| 65 W | TDP | 35 W |
| Conroe | Codename | Merom |
| LGA775 | Package | PPGA478 |
